Stainless steel and high-temperature alloys offer optimal durability and heat resistance for industrial burners, while cast iron provides cost-effective strength and ceramic components enhance thermal efficiency in specific configurations.
Flame scanners continuously monitor burner ignition and flame presence, automatically shutting off fuel supply if flame failure is detected, preventing dangerous fuel accumulation and ensuring safe operation in industrial settings.
Regular inspection and cleaning of burner nozzles is essential to prevent clogging from fuel impurities, ensure proper fuel-air mixture, maintain flame stability, and optimize combustion efficiency in machinery applications.
